1. Religious Tourism In Uttar Pradesh
Vinod Khanal latest report in leading daily Economic Times states that The Uttar Pradesh State Tourism Development Corporation Limited (UPTDCL) plans to introduce aerial system passenger ropeway for the tourists visiting in large number in Ashtabhuja and Kalikoh temples of Vindhyachal located in Mirzapur and Lakshman Pahari located in Chitrakoot. Public private partnership (PPP) will be used for building the ropeways and this will help in boosting the percentage of religious visits in this state of Uttar Pradesh.
Chairman, UPTDCL, Sudip Ranjan Sen, in his last visit to the city for inspection of Triveni Darshan at Boat Club, clearly stated as every year there are some lakhs of tourists visiting the temples over here and other pilgrimage sites, so they have planned for promoting this tourism in these areas with development of infrastructure. Development process is already started and also bids invited from private players in this regard. INR: 20 Crore sanctioned by corporation for Ramghat renovation in Chitrakoot.
Besides infrastructure there is also plan to launch aerial sports as a tourist attracting feature in Kalinjar. Upgradation already proposed for 13 hotels of UPTDCL for adding new facilities. An amount of INR: 13 Crore sanctioned for facility addition in hotels plus for tourist packages for attracting tourists from overseas countries. Plan is also there to utilize 32 acre vacant plot at Fatehpur Sikri as a spot for recreation for foreign tourists as confirmed by Mt. Sudip Ranjan Sen.
